Output d645861ef990bb70bf8fc1cb57117b6a32940117dfed98bbb768a2e59c767225:0

value
1095234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c05ccca38c6a22d0d520ea084818fff9cd601fa2 OP_EQUAL
address
3KE8qBtMtzR3tpoNVgk9p1wHRuuY7hfMNT
transaction
d645861ef990bb70bf8fc1cb57117b6a32940117dfed98bbb768a2e59c767225
spent
true